Air Grippers Market Size, Share 2026


MARKET INSIGHTS

Global Air Grippers market size was valued at USD 632 million in 2025. The market is projected to grow from USD 664 million in 2026 to USD 877 million by 2034, exhibiting a CAGR of 5.0% during the forecast period.

Air grippers, also referred to as pneumatic grippers, are automated end-of-arm tooling devices that utilize compressed air to actuate jaws or fingers for picking, placing, holding, and assembling components across a wide range of manufacturing environments. These devices deliver a compelling combination of cost-efficiency, high gripping force in compact form factors, rapid actuation speed, and minimal maintenance requirements, making them a preferred choice for robotic systems and automated assembly lines. Their versatility spans applications handling objects as delicate as microelectronic chips and as substantial as automotive engine blocks. Global air gripper production is projected to reach 865,000 units by 2025, with an average unit price of approximately USD 800, while gross profit margins across the industry typically range between 30% and 50%.

The market is witnessing steady expansion driven by the rapid adoption of industrial automation and robotics, rising labor costs across manufacturing economies, and intensifying downstream demand for operational efficiency and process consistency. However, the industry faces certain headwinds, including dependence on a stable compressed air infrastructure, growing competitive pressure from electric grippers in high-precision handling tasks, and increased price competition stemming from product standardization. Key players operating in the global air grippers landscape include SMC, Festo, SCHUNK, Parker Hannifin, Zimmer Group, and several other established manufacturers with broad product portfolios serving diverse industrial segments.

MARKET CHALLENGES

Substitution Pressure from Electric Grippers Challenging Pneumatic Dominance

The Air Grippers market enjoys steady growth, yet faces notable hurdles from technological shifts and operational dependencies. Electric grippers are gaining traction for high-precision and complex handling tasks, offering programmable force control and feedback without air infrastructure. This substitution pressure is particularly acute in cleanroom-heavy electronics and semiconductor applications, where pneumatic systems' air consumption and potential contamination risks pose drawbacks. Manufacturers must differentiate through cost advantages and raw power, but as electric models mature and prices drop, market share erosion looms for traditional pneumatic solutions.

Other Challenges

Dependence on Stable Compressed Air Supply

Reliable air supply remains critical, yet fluctuations in pressure or quality can compromise gripping performance and repeatability. Industries with inconsistent pneumatic infrastructure encounter higher failure rates, deterring adoption in remote or variable setups. Mitigating this requires additional investments in compressors and filters, escalating system costs.

Intensified Price Competition and Standardization

Product standardization fuels cutthroat pricing among suppliers, squeezing margins despite healthy 30-50% gross profits. Overcapacity in Asia and commoditization of basic parallel grippers challenge premium players to justify innovations through value-added features like sensor integration.

MARKET RESTRAINTS

Supply Chain Vulnerabilities and Skilled Workforce Shortages Restraining Expansion

Air grippers depend heavily on upstream supplies including metal materials, engineering plastics, seals, springs, bearings, and machined pneumatic components, which dictate durability, service life, and actuation speed. Disruptions in these chains, as seen in recent global events, inflate costs and delay deliveries, hampering production scalability. While the market projects 865,000 units by 2025, volatility in raw material prices particularly aluminum and stainless steel poses ongoing risks, especially for high-force models in automotive applications.

Additionally, the sector grapples with a shortage of skilled professionals proficient in pneumatic system integration and robotics programming. Rapid automation growth outpaces talent development, with retirements exacerbating gaps in engineering expertise. This limits adoption in complex setups requiring custom configurations like rotary or airbag grippers, ultimately curbing market penetration. Companies face prolonged commissioning times and suboptimal performance, underscoring the need for workforce upskilling to unlock full potential.

Air Grippers Market Trends

Advancements in Sensor Integration and Modular Designs to Emerge as a Key Trend in the Market

The air grippers market is witnessing transformative advancements in sensor integration and modular designs, which are revolutionizing industrial automation by enabling intelligent gripping capabilities. These pneumatic tools, valued at $632 million in 2025 and projected to reach $877 million by 2034 with a steady CAGR of 5.0%, are increasingly equipped with proximity sensors, force sensors, and position feedback systems. This allows for real-time condition monitoring, adaptive gripping force adjustment, and predictive maintenance, significantly enhancing operational reliability and reducing downtime in high-speed assembly lines. Furthermore, modular designs facilitate easy customization, allowing users to swap fingers or jaws for diverse part handling from delicate semiconductors to robust engine components without overhauling entire robotic systems. As production cycles shorten and flexible manufacturing gains traction, these innovations address key demands for precision and versatility, making air grippers indispensable in robotics applications where speed and cost-efficiency remain paramount. Global production is expected to hit 865,000 units by 2025 at an average price of $800 per unit, underscoring the scalability of these trends amid rising automation needs.
